INTRODUCTION: The post-call state in postgraduate medical trainees is associated with impaired decision-making and increased medical errors. An association between post-call state and medication prescription errors for surgery residents is yet to be established. Our objective was to determine whether post-call state is associated with increased proportion of medication prescription errors committed by surgery residents in an academic hospital without a computerized physician order entry (CPOE) system. METHODS: This prospective observational study was conducted at a tertiary academic hospital between June 28 and August 31, 2017. It compared the proportion of medication prescription errors committed by surgery residents in their post-call (PC) and no-call (NC) states. A novel taxonomy was developed to classify medication prescription errors. RESULTS: Sixteen of twenty-one eligible residents (76%) participated in this study. Self-reported hours of sleep per night was significantly higher in the NC group compared to the PC group (6(4-8) vs 2(0-4) hours, P < 0.01). PC residents committed a significantly higher proportion of medication prescription errors versus NC residents (9.2% vs 3.2%; p=0.04). Decision-making and prescription-writing errors comprised 33% and 67% of errors, respectively. CONCLUSIONS: The post-call state in surgery residents is associated with a significantly higher proportion of medication prescription errors in a hospital without a CPOE system. Decision-making and prescription-writing errors could potentially be addressed by additional educational interventions.

OBJECTIVES: Educational interventions with proven effectiveness to reduce medication prescribing errors are currently lacking. Our objective was to implement and assess the effectiveness of a curriculum to reduce medication prescribing errors on a surgery service. METHODS: This was a prospective observational cohort study at a Canadian academic hospital without an electronic order entry system. A pharmacist-led medication prescribing curriculum for surgery residents was developed and implemented over 2 days (2 h/day) in July 2019. Thirteen (76%) out of 17 surgery residents contributed pre-implementation data, while 13 (81%) out of 16 surgery residents contributed post-implementation data. Medication prescribing errors were tracked for 12 months pre-implementation and 6 months post-implementation. Errors were classified as prescription writing (PW) or decision making (DM). RESULTS: There were a total of 1050 medication prescribing errors made in the pre-implementation period with 615 (59%) PW errors and 435 (41%) DM. There were a mean of 87.5 (SD = 14.6) total medication prescribing errors per month in the pre-implementation period with 51.3 (11.9) PW and 36.3 (6.0) DM errors. There were a total of 472 medication prescribing errors made in the post-implementation period with 260 (55%) PW and 212 (45%) DM errors. There were a mean of 78.7 (10.3) total medication prescribing errors per month in the post-implementation period with 43.3 (9.5) PW and 35.3 (4.2) DM errors. In the first quarter of the academic year, there were significantly fewer mean total errors per month post-implementation versus pre-implementation (77.7(12.7) versus 107.3(8.1); P = .035), with significantly fewer PW errors per month (40.7(13.2) versus 68.7(9.3); P = .046) and no difference in DM errors per month (37.0(2.0) versus 38.7(5.7);P = .671). There were no differences noted in the second quarter of the academic year. CONCLUSION: Medication prescribing errors occurred from PW and DM. Medication prescribing curriculum decreased PW errors; however, a continued education program is warranted as the effect diminished over time.

BACKGROUND: Four-corner fusion (4CF) is a common treatment for midcarpal arthritis; however, alternatives including 2-corner fusion (2CF) and 3-corner fusion (3CF) have been described. Limited literature suggests 2CF and 3CF may improve range of motion but have higher complication rates. Our objective is to compare function and patient-reported outcomes following 4CF, 3CF, and 2CF at our institution. METHODS: Adult patients undergoing 4CF, 3CF, and 2CF from 2011 to 2021 who attended at least one follow-up were included. Four-corner fusion patients were compared with those who underwent either 3CF or 2CF using staple fixation. Outcomes include nonunion rate, reoperation rate, progression to wrist fusion, range of motion, and patient-reported pain, satisfaction, and Disabilities of the Arm, Shoulder, and Hand (DASH) scores. RESULTS: A total of 58 patients met inclusion criteria. There were 49 4CF and 9 2CF or 3CF patients. Nonunion rates, progression to wrist fusion, and repeat surgery for any indication were not significantly different among groups. Range of motion (flexion-extension, radial-ulnar deviation) and grip strength at postoperative visits were not significantly different. Significantly more 4CF patients required bone grafting. Pain, overall satisfaction, and DASH scores were similar. CONCLUSIONS: Although prior studies suggest increased risk of nonunion and hardware migration after 2CF/3CF, we did not observe higher complication rates compared with 4CF. Range of motion, strength, and patient-reported outcomes were similar. While 4CF is traditionally the procedure of choice for midcarpal fusion, we found that when using a staple fixation technique, 2CF and 3CF have comparable clinical and patient-reported outcomes yet decrease the need for autologous bone grafting.

Although many reviews describe significant advances in burn care, no studies have yet examined why these papers had such profound impact. Our objective was to identify the most highly cited, as well as the most clinically influential studies in burns, and describe their characteristics, to inform future research in the field. Web of Science was searched using keywords related to burns to identify the 100 most-cited burns papers. Study design, year and journal of publication, and subject of the paper were recorded. A mixed-methods approach was used to identify papers in burn research leading to change in clinical practice. Characteristics of these papers were compared with identify any factors predictive of future citations or clinical influence. The 100 highly cited papers were cited between 159 and 907 times. There was no correlation between total citations and journal impact factor, year of publication, or subject area. Level of evidence did not predict future citations or influence, but may be influenced by evolving research standards. Of 23 clinically influential studies, 6 were not among 100 most-cited. Using papers only from the 100 most-cited list was not sufficient to identify leading researchers in burns. Citation analysis is a beneficial, however not alone sufficient to identify landmark papers, particularly for multidisciplinary fields such as burns.

Severe burns induce a profound hypermetabolic response, leading to a prolonged state of catabolism associated with organ dysfunction and delay of wound healing. Oxandrolone, a synthetic testosterone analog, may alleviate the hypermetabolic catabolic state thereby decreasing associated morbidity. However, current literature has reported mixed outcomes on complications following Oxandrolone use, specifically liver and lung function. We conducted an updated systematic review and meta-analysis studying the effects of Oxandrolone on mortality, length of hospital stay, progressive liver dysfunction, and nine secondary outcomes. We searched Pubmed, EMBASE, Web of Science, CINAHL, and Cochrane Databases of Systematic Reviews and Randomized Controlled Trials. Thirty-one randomized control trials and observational studies were included. Basic science and animal studies were excluded. Only studies comparing Oxandrolone to standard of care, or placebo, were included. Oxandrolone did not affect rates of mortality (relative risk [RR]: 0.72; 95% confidence interval [CI]: 0.47 to 1.08; P = .11) or progressive liver dysfunction (RR: 1.04; 95% CI: 0.59 to 1.85; P = .88), but did decrease length of stay in hospital. Oxandrolone significantly increased weight regain, bone mineral density, percent lean body mass, and decreased wound healing time for donor graft sites. Oxandrolone did not change the incidence of transient liver dysfunction or mechanical ventilation requirements. There is evidence to suggest that Oxandrolone is a beneficial adjunct to the acute care of burn patients; shortening hospital stays and improving several growth and wound healing parameters. It does not appear that Oxandrolone increases the risk of progressive or transient liver injury, although monitoring liver enzymes is recommended.

BACKGROUND: In competency-based medical education, progression between milestones requires reliable and valid methods of assessment. Surgery Tutor is an open-source motion tracking platform developed to objectively assess technical proficiency during open soft-tissue tumor resections in a simulated setting. The objective of our study was to provide evidence in support of construct validity of the scores obtained by Surgery Tutor. We hypothesized that Surgery Tutor would discriminate between novice, intermediate, and experienced operators. METHODS: Thirty participants were assigned to novice, intermediate, or experienced groups, based on the number of prior soft-tissue resections performed. Each participant resected 2 palpable and 2 nonpalpable lesions from a soft-tissue phantom. Surgery Tutor was used to track hand and instrument motions, number of tumor breaches, and time to perform each resection. Mass of excised specimens and margin status were also recorded. RESULTS: Surgery Tutor scores demonstrated "moderate" to "good" internal structure (test-retest reliability) for novice, intermediate, and experienced groups (interclass correlation coefficient = 0.596, 0.569, 0.737; p < 0.001). Evidence in support of construct validity (consequences) was demonstrated by comparing scores of novice, intermediate, and experienced participantsfor number of hand and instrument motions (690 ± 190, 597 ± 169, 469 ± 110; p < 0.001), number of tumor breaches (29 ± 34, 16 ± 11, 9 ± 6; p < 0.001), time per resection (677 ± 331 seconds, 561 ± 210 seconds, 449 ± 148 seconds; p < 0.001), mass of completely excised specimens (22 ± 7g, 21 ± 11g, 17 ± 6 g; p = 0.035), and rate of positive margin (68%, 50%, 28%; p < 0.001). There was "strong" and "moderate" relationships between motion scores and Objective Structured Assessment of Technical Skill scores, and time per resection and Objective Structured Assessment of Technical Skill scores respectively (r = -0.60, p < 0.001; r = -0.54, p < 0.001). CONCLUSION: Surgery Tutor scores demonstrate evidenceof construct validity with regards to good internal structure, consequences, and relationship to other variables in the assessment of technical proficiency duringopen soft-tissue tumor resections in a simulated setting. Utilization of Surgery Tutor can provide formative feedback and objective assessment of surgical proficiency in a simulated setting.
